Ulgii vs Missoula, Mt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Ulgii, Mongolia and Missoula, Mt, Usa is approximately 9,108 km or 5,660 mi.
  • To reach Ulgii in this distance one would set out from Missoula, Mt bearing 344.3°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Ulgii bearing 196.3° or SSW .
  • Ulgii has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k) whereas Missoula, Mt has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Ulgii is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Missoula, Mt is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.5 °C (11.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.9 °C (16°F) more in Ulgii.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 228.2 mm (9 in) less which is equivalent to 228.2 l/m² (5.6 US gal/ft²) or 2,282,000 l/ha (243,961 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2° lower in Ulgii than in Missoula, Mt.
